在当今前端开发领域,TypeScript作为JavaScript的超集,已经成为了许多开发者的首选。它不仅提供了静态类型检查,增强了代码的可维护性和可读性,还与多种现代前端框架紧密集成。掌握TypeScript,无疑能让你在众多开发者中脱颖而出。接下来,就让我们一起来了解一下那些与TypeScript紧密结合的前端框架吧!
1. React
React是由Facebook开发的一款用于构建用户界面的JavaScript库。自从2013年发布以来,它已经成为了前端开发领域最受欢迎的框架之一。React与TypeScript的结合,使得开发者能够更高效地构建大型、可维护的UI组件。
TypeScript在React中的应用:
- 类型安全:React组件的props和state可以通过TypeScript进行类型注解,减少运行时错误。
- 更好的开发体验:TypeScript提供的智能提示和代码自动完成功能,能够大大提高开发效率。
2. Vue.js
Vue.js是一款渐进式JavaScript框架,它允许开发者使用HTML模板、JavaScript和CSS来构建用户界面。Vue.js与TypeScript的结合,使得开发大型应用变得更加简单。
TypeScript在Vue.js中的应用:
- 类型安全:Vue组件的props和data可以通过TypeScript进行类型注解。
- 更好的开发体验:TypeScript提供的智能提示和代码自动完成功能,能够提高开发效率。
3. Angular
Angular是由Google开发的一款用于构建大型单页应用的前端框架。它采用了模块化、组件化的设计理念,并提供了丰富的功能。Angular与TypeScript的结合,使得开发大型应用变得更加高效。
TypeScript在Angular中的应用:
- 类型安全:Angular组件的inputs和outputs可以通过TypeScript进行类型注解。
- 更好的开发体验:TypeScript提供的智能提示和代码自动完成功能,能够提高开发效率。
4. Svelte
Svelte是一款相对较新的前端框架,它通过将组件编译成原生JavaScript,从而避免了虚拟DOM的渲染开销。Svelte与TypeScript的结合,使得开发者能够构建高性能的UI组件。
TypeScript在Svelte中的应用:
- 类型安全:Svelte组件的props可以通过TypeScript进行类型注解。
- 更好的开发体验:TypeScript提供的智能提示和代码自动完成功能,能够提高开发效率。
总结
掌握TypeScript,可以帮助你更好地理解现代前端框架的原理,提高开发效率。以上提到的框架都是与TypeScript紧密结合的前端框架,它们在各自的领域都有着广泛的应用。希望这篇文章能帮助你更好地了解这些框架,并在实际开发中发挥出它们的优势。
